It Bites are a British progressive/pop-rock band formed in Egremont, Cumbria, in 1982. The original lineup featured Francis Dunnery, John Beck, Dick Nolan, and Bob Dalton, scoring a UK hit with Calling All the Heroes in 1986. Reformed in the mid-2000s with John Mitchell on vocals/guitar, they released The Tall Ships (2008) and Map of the Past (2012).

Formed in Egremont, Cumbria (1982). Original members: Francis Dunnery (vocals, guitar), John Beck (keyboards), Dick Nolan (bass), Bob Dalton (drums). UK Top 10 single: Calling All the Heroes (1986). Key albums: The Big Lad in the Windmill (1986), Once Around the World (1988), Eat Me in St. Louis (1989), The Tall Ships (2008), Map of the Past (2012).

Reviews praise It Bites’ blend of progressive flair and pop-savvy hooks across their 1980s albums and 2008 comeback. The Tall Ships is highlighted as a no-filler return with John Mitchell on vocals/guitar. Classic cuts like Calling All the Heroes, Underneath Your Pillow, Kiss Like Judas, and Yellow Christian receive nods. The band’s tight arrangements, harmonies, and tasteful virtuosity are recurring strengths.
